Go back Great Ormond Street Hospital for Children NHS Foundation Trust Rotational Physiotherapist The closing date is 11 December 2025 We are seeking motivated, kind, and enthusiastic Physiotherapists who are eager to specialise in paediatrics. The post is rotational and involves 8-month rotations across various specialities, including cardiorespiratory, neurology, oncology, orthopaedics, neuromuscular, rheumatology, and neurodisability. There are many opportunities to develop knowledge and skills, including opportunities in teaching and research. Great Ormond Street Hospital is located in central London close to Covent Garden and Oxford Street. The Trust values all their staff and has been awarded the Improving Working Lives Practice Plus standard. There is support for research activity and your CPD through provision of study leave and funding. There are also generous staff benefits available including subsidised accommodations. Main duties of the job The department is integrated with the Occupational Therapy Team and provides great opportunities for MDT working. The rotations available include areas such as Neurology, Orthopaedics, Respiratory, Rheumatology and Oncology to name a few. If you are looking for an opportunity to develop your skills in providing expert physiotherapy to children and young people then this post is ideal.
